Google Pixel 5a finally officially launched, it is positioned as a cheaper successor to Pixel 4a 5G, rather than a successor to Pixel 4a equipped with 4G. Google took a similar approach to Pixel 4a last year, cutting the price by $50 compared to Pixel 3a.

Is the new mid-ranger a hot device or do you think Google scored an own goal? You can vote in our poll below, if you have more ideas, please leave a comment.

The Pixel 5a starts at $449 and has a lot in common with the Pixel 4a 5G, for better or worse. We have the same Snapdragon 765G chipset, dual rear camera system (12MP main camera, 16MP ultra-wide angle) and a similar 60Hz OLED screen. Therefore, you do not see a huge upgrade at first glance.

However, the new phone does include some welcome upgrades in other categories. There is a 4,680mAh battery, a massive upgrade to the Pixel 4a 5G and Pixel 5 (although with 18W charging and no wireless charging), and an IP67 rating, which provides better durability. You will also get a metal backplate, which seems to be the material of choice for many readers. Coupled with the price reduction of its predecessor, you get a very reliable packaging.
